Neuroimaging monitors Alzheimer's disease

Thursday, February 11, 2010 - 09:07 in Health & Medicine

SAN FRANCISCO, Feb. 11 (UPI) -- U.S. medical researchers say a new neuroimaging technique might soon pave the way for effective early identification of Alzheimer's disease in living people.
